Worker Recruitment with Distributionally Robust Optimization in Mobile Crowd Sensing

Mobile crowd sensing (MCS) is an emerging sensing paradigm that leverages mobile devices for large-scale data collection, where an MCS platform recruits workers to perform time-sensitive sensing tasks. In practice, worker travel times are inherently uncertain due to dynamic urban environments—traffic congestion, road closures, and unplanned detours cause actual delays to deviate from historical patterns. However, existing worker recruitment methods typically optimize expected-case performance based on static historical distributions, providing no robustness guarantee under distribution shift. To address these challenges, this paper proposes DRO-IGR, a worker recruitment framework based on Distributionally Robust Optimization (DRO) and an Iterative Greedy Recruitment algorithm. The framework introduces a DRO Probability Estimation Engine that treats each worker’s true delay distribution as lying within a Wasserstein ambiguity set centered on its empirical history, with a radius that adapts to data sparsity, behavioral variability, and task importance. Strong duality reduces the resulting worst-case optimization to an efficient one-dimensional convex search. Driven by these robust probability estimates, a marginal-gain scoring rule iteratively selects worker–task pairs that maximize importance-weighted robust utility per unit cost. Extensive experiments on three synthetic spatial distributions and the real-world T-Drive Beijing taxi dataset show that, compared to existing approaches, DRO-IGR completes more tasks, achieves a higher total importance sum, and attains greater utility within the same budget constraint.
